EF-1 Tornado Confirmed by National Weather Service
The U.S. National Weather Service in Cheyenne confirms an F1 Tornado hit the Morrill/ Mitchell area Thursday afternoon. Creighton University regional survey shows “rural mainstreet” economy down for 10th straight month
High interest rates, along with weak farm commodity prices and equipment sales, helped push a regional “rural mainstreet” economic index tracked by Omaha’s Creighton University to below growth neutral for the 10th month in a row. Mountain Lion hunting season approved for Wildcat Hills
The Nebraska Game and Parks Commission approved staff recommendations for a 2025 mountain lion hunting season at its June 21 meeting in Ogallala. https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=NQcqd9JuW1A For the first time, a hunting season will take place in the Wildcat Hills.
